Ignition Repair

The ignition system is the bridge that connects your car battery to its starter, ensuring with a turn of the key, your engine will roar to life. It’s an intricately designed piece of machinery, and any issue with one element can easily cause you to be stranded. It’s important to be aware of warning signs such as the stiffness of a key or malfunctioning ignition in your car and contact a professional locksmith.

A dead ignition switch is the first thing to be looking for. This will manifest as your vehicle slowing down while driving, with no apparent reason other than it’s not getting enough power. This is a very risky situation. It is best to stop the vehicle immediately and call for roadside assistance. Your vehicle will need to be restarted in order to continue to move.

A professional locksmith can determine the cause of the problem with your ignition switch. In some cases, a simple duplication or re-cut will solve the issue, but in others the ignition cylinder may require replacement. This is a hefty task that requires dismantling the steering column to access the cylinder’s ignition lock mechanism. During this process, the locksmith will replace any damaged parts and ensure that the cylinder lock for the ignition is working properly before reassembling it and testing it out.

Over time the cylinder that controls ignition of your vehicle may be damaged as a result of normal wear and tear or by a heavy key chain. These things could cause the tumblers in the cylinder’s ignition to shift, leading to an unresolved lockout. A locksmith will be capable of identifying the issue and perform the necessary repair quickly, cost-effectively, and without affecting your vehicle’s warranty.

Rekeying

Rekeying is a method that can be done by a locksmith close to you to change the lock to function with a new key. The key that was originally installed won’t fit in the lock any longer because the internal components, such as pins and springs, are replaced with different ones that will accommodate a new key. It’s cheaper than buying the cylinder of a new lock, because you don’t need to buy all the components.
